Message type: E = Error
Message class: IQ -
Message number: 400
Message text: messages from the Customizing

- messages from the Customizing ?The SAP error message IQ400 typically relates to issues in the customizing settings of the SAP system, particularly in the context of the SAP IS (Industry Solution) modules. The error message can indicate that there is a problem with the configuration or settings that are required for a specific process or transaction.
Cause:
The IQ400 error message can arise due to several reasons, including but not limited to:
- Missing Customizing Settings: Required customizing settings may not have been maintained in the system.
- Inconsistent Data: There may be inconsistencies in the data that are causing the system to fail in processing a transaction.
-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to access certain customizing settings.
- Incorrect Configuration: The configuration settings may be incorrect or incomplete, leading to the error.
Solution:
To resolve the IQ400 error message, you can follow these steps:
Check Customizing Settings:
- Navigate to the relevant customizing transaction (e.g., SPRO) and verify that all necessary settings are correctly maintained.
- Ensure that all required entries are present and correctly configured.
Review Documentation:
- Consult the SAP documentation or help files related to the specific module you are working with to understand the required settings.
Data Consistency Check:
- Perform a consistency check on the data involved in the transaction to ensure there are no discrepancies.
Authorization Check:
- Verify that the user has the necessary authorizations to access and modify the customizing settings.
Consult SAP Notes:
- Check the SAP Support Portal for any relevant SAP Notes that may address the IQ400 error message. There may be specific patches or updates that resolve known issues.
Testing:
- After making changes, test the transaction again to see if the error persists.
